USO Naval Base Guam hosted the launch of the USO Indo-Pacific’s partnership with Enterprise.
“Enterprise Day” at USO NBG kicked off with an island style fiesta luncheon for service members and an ice cream social for kids and families. Members of Enterprise Guam’s management team and staff supported the launch in conjunction with USO Staff and Volunteers. Chefs from Enterprise were onsite at the USO Center at Naval Base Guam, they provided traditional and authentic cuisine from the island which included crispy fried pork belly (Lechon Kawali), chicken Kelaguen, Chamorro-style red rice, Filipino-style beef steak and more. Over 150 service members and guests enjoyed the special menu and were thrilled to have a taste of the local cuisine and celebrate our great partnership.
